70 Codefresh Reseñas
Todas las integraciones son realmente fáciles de hacer, en este momento soy el único que trabaja en Codefresh y no fue nada difícil implementar todo por mí mismo, todo está bien documentado. Reseña recopilada por y alojada en G2.com.
El proveedor de Terraform está un poco desactualizado, ese es mi único punto, no puedo crear todo lo que quiero usando Terraform en sí mismo, creo que Codefresh debería invertir un poco de tiempo trabajando en eso. Reseña recopilada por y alojada en G2.com.
La integración de primera clase de Kubernetes facilita la adopción de un despliegue de entrega continua "por rama". Esta poderosa característica se puede aprovechar junto con las características de plantillas y variables de canalización para realmente estandarizar y simplificar CI/CD en toda una organización. Reseña recopilada por y alojada en G2.com.
Aunque es posible crear disparadores para las canalizaciones desde la interfaz de usuario, los disparadores son una parte relevante de la configuración de las canalizaciones CI/CD y deben definirse como código y versionarse también. Reseña recopilada por y alojada en G2.com.
Las canalizaciones de Codefresh tienen sentido. La configuración YAML y el diseño del proyecto/canalización son muy intuitivos, y su documentación es en general bastante buena. El modelo de precios es simple y directo.
Las canalizaciones y los pasos son muy personalizables, y ejecutarlos con condicionales o en paralelo los hace súper personalizables. La interfaz web es excelente para escribir canalizaciones de prueba de concepto y probarlas; luego, puedes comprometerlas a un repositorio y vincular la fuente a una rama para que se origine desde tu repositorio.
La gestión de secretos es muy sencilla, y poder pasar diferentes configuraciones compartidas basadas en qué disparadores de git se activan es beneficioso para crear canalizaciones simples.
La conexión a k8s está bien documentada, y rápidamente añadí la configuración necesaria en mi código de terraform para que sea parte de mi infraestructura como código. Tener los perfiles de configuración disponibles en todos los pasos es muy conveniente.
Sus equipos de ventas y soporte son excelentes y muy receptivos a comentarios y preocupaciones. Reseña recopilada por y alojada en G2.com.
No hay mucho que no guste de Codefresh: lo peor para mí es que hay algunos errores menores en la interfaz de usuario que ocurren constantemente y que debes conocer, o de lo contrario te causarán dolores de cabeza con resultados inesperados.
El almacenamiento en caché es excelente ya que se maneja automáticamente. Sin embargo, a veces puede ser malo, ya que ejecutar múltiples instancias de la misma canalización puede resultar en que las nuevas ejecuciones no utilicen los recursos en caché. Reseña recopilada por y alojada en G2.com.

Interfaz de usuario + toda la flexibilidad para agregar pasos personalizados + el mercado Reseña recopilada por y alojada en G2.com.
La documentación a veces es un poco engañosa y terminas necesitando hacer preguntas en el foro. Reseña recopilada por y alojada en G2.com.
Me gusta que esté basado en contenedores, que sea fácil de usar registros de contenedores de terceros e internos. El formato YAML para la especificación de la canalización también debería ser algo natural para cualquier persona de DevOps. He encontrado que la documentación es excelente. Reseña recopilada por y alojada en G2.com.
He tenido algunos problemas de estabilidad con CodeFresh. No pude iniciar mi pipeline (los contenedores no se estaban iniciando). Tuve que contactar al soporte al cliente durante mi evaluación para que me pusieran en un nivel diferente para ver mis contenedores funcionando. Me retrasó un día en mi trabajo, lo cual no esperaba. Revisaría el SLA antes de registrarme para un servicio completo.
Es algo confuso cómo se pueden añadir servicios como sidecar.
No hay ejemplos de cómo se podrían aprovechar servicios en la nube de terceros para acceder a aplicaciones desplegadas dentro del pipeline. Reseña recopilada por y alojada en G2.com.
Simplicidad y facilidad de uso. Es fácil de usar. Fácil de integrar con servicios en la nube como AWS o Azure. El tiempo de respuesta a las preguntas o problemas de soporte técnico es rápido. Reseña recopilada por y alojada en G2.com.
1. El manejo de errores no es el mejor.
2. Requiere pasos adicionales para adaptarse a nuestro proceso de desarrollo. Reseña recopilada por y alojada en G2.com.
La simplicidad de las configuraciones del pipeline. Reseña recopilada por y alojada en G2.com.
El almacenamiento en caché no siempre funciona como se espera. Algunas imágenes de la tubería tienen problemas para actualizar las variables de entorno. Reseña recopilada por y alojada en G2.com.

La característica más útil que me encantó de Codefresh es lo fácil que es conectar tu proyecto desde Github y lo automatizado que puede llegar a ser al ejecutar las compilaciones. Usarlo para el trabajo hace que todo sea mucho más fácil de seguir porque tan pronto como se ha realizado un cambio, se ejecuta una compilación y nos notifican instantáneamente sobre el estado de la compilación. Otra parte muy útil es la documentación, que es increíble, y la encontré muy detallada. Reseña recopilada por y alojada en G2.com.
En general, no tengo nada en particular que me desagrade. Todo sobre la interfaz de usuario es bastante intuitivo y fácil de seguir. He notado algunos problemas de estabilidad de vez en cuando, pero se solucionaron muy rápidamente. Reseña recopilada por y alojada en G2.com.
La facilidad de uso, configuración e integración simple con nuestros contenedores Docker de AWS ECR. La implementación se simplifica en todos nuestros entornos. Reseña recopilada por y alojada en G2.com.
Hasta ahora todo ha funcionado muy bien, no hay disgustos que mencionar en este momento. La única pregunta que tenemos podría ser el costo frente a Github Actions. Reseña recopilada por y alojada en G2.com.